The average rent in Lakeview is $903 per month as of September 2026. This is 52% below the national average rent, or $997 less per month.

Compare rent prices in Lakeview, MI

Rent prices in Lakeview vary by bedroom size, rental type, and neighborhood. The average rent for an apartment in Lakeview is $900, whereas a house costs $1,950. 1-bedroom apartments in Lakeview run $803 on average, while 2-bedroom apartments are $1,095.

What salary do I need to afford rent in Lakeview?

To comfortably afford rent in Lakeview, you'd need to earn approximately $36,000/year, based on spending no more than 30% of your income on rent.

Methodology

Rent prices are based on Zumper's rental listings from the past 30 days. Median rent is calculated across all available listings and property types on the platform. If you filter the page by bedroom count or property type, the pricing throughout the page will update automatically to reflect that segment of the rental market.

Household and population data come from the U.S. Census Bureau. Cost-of-living data is sourced from the Council for Community and Economic Research's Cost of Living Index (COLI).
